Tampere Market Hall
Tampere Market Hall is one of the significant market places in Tampere, Finland. It is located in the center of city, between Hämeenkatu and Hallituskatu, and it was opened in 1901.Photo: Cryonic07, CC BY-SA 3.0.

Tampere City Hall
Town hall
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Tampere City Hall is a Neo-Renaissance building in Tampere, Finland, situated at the edge of the Tampere Central Square. The current city hall was built in 1890 and was designed by Georg Schreck. Tampere City Hall is situated 120 metres north of Tampere Market Hall.
Tampere Theatre
Theater building
Photo: Juho Paavisto, Public domain.
The Tampere Theatre is one of the two main active theatres in Tampere, Finland, along with the Tampere Workers' Theatre. The theatre was started in 1904 and the opening ceremony was held in 1913. Tampere Theatre is situated 240 metres northeast of Tampere Market Hall.
Tampere Stadium
Stadium
Photo: Kallerna,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Tampere Stadium, also known as Ratina Stadium is a multi-purpose stadium in Tampere, Finland. It has a seating capacity of 16,800 people, and a capacity of up to 32,000 people for concerts. Tampere Stadium is situated 540 metres southeast of Tampere Market Hall.
